public class PolicyUtilsTest extends Assert {

    private IMocksControl control;
   
    @Before
    public void setUp() {
        control = EasyMock.createNiceControl();
    }
   
    @Test
    public void testRMAssertionEquals() {
        RMAssertion a = new RMAssertion();
        assertTrue(RM10PolicyUtils.equals(a, a));
       
        RMAssertion b = new RMAssertion();
        assertTrue(RM10PolicyUtils.equals(a, b));
       
        InactivityTimeout iat = new RMAssertion.InactivityTimeout();
        iat.setMilliseconds(new Long(10));
        a.setInactivityTimeout(iat);
        assertTrue(!RM10PolicyUtils.equals(a, b));
        b.setInactivityTimeout(iat);
        assertTrue(RM10PolicyUtils.equals(a, b));
       
        ExponentialBackoff eb = new RMAssertion.ExponentialBackoff();
        a.setExponentialBackoff(eb);
        assertTrue(!RM10PolicyUtils.equals(a, b));
        b.setExponentialBackoff(eb);
        assertTrue(RM10PolicyUtils.equals(a, b));   
    }
   
    @Test
    public void testIntersect() {
        RMAssertion a = new RMAssertion();
        RMAssertion b = new RMAssertion();
        assertSame(a, RM10PolicyUtils.intersect(a, b));
       
        InactivityTimeout aiat = new RMAssertion.InactivityTimeout();
        aiat.setMilliseconds(new Long(3600000));
        a.setInactivityTimeout(aiat);
        InactivityTimeout biat = new RMAssertion.InactivityTimeout();
        biat.setMilliseconds(new Long(7200000));
        b.setInactivityTimeout(biat);
       
        RMAssertion c = RM10PolicyUtils.intersect(a, b);
        assertEquals(7200000L, c.getInactivityTimeout().getMilliseconds().longValue());
        assertNull(c.getBaseRetransmissionInterval());
        assertNull(c.getAcknowledgementInterval());
        assertNull(c.getExponentialBackoff());
       
        BaseRetransmissionInterval abri = new RMAssertion.BaseRetransmissionInterval();
        abri.setMilliseconds(new Long(10000));
        a.setBaseRetransmissionInterval(abri);
        BaseRetransmissionInterval bbri = new RMAssertion.BaseRetransmissionInterval();
        bbri.setMilliseconds(new Long(20000));
        b.setBaseRetransmissionInterval(bbri);
       
        c = RM10PolicyUtils.intersect(a, b);
        assertEquals(7200000L, c.getInactivityTimeout().getMilliseconds().longValue());
        assertEquals(20000L, c.getBaseRetransmissionInterval().getMilliseconds().longValue());
        assertNull(c.getAcknowledgementInterval());
        assertNull(c.getExponentialBackoff());
      
        AcknowledgementInterval aai = new RMAssertion.AcknowledgementInterval();
        aai.setMilliseconds(new Long(2000));
        a.setAcknowledgementInterval(aai);
       
        c = RM10PolicyUtils.intersect(a, b);
        assertEquals(7200000L, c.getInactivityTimeout().getMilliseconds().longValue());
        assertEquals(20000L, c.getBaseRetransmissionInterval().getMilliseconds().longValue());
        assertEquals(2000L, c.getAcknowledgementInterval().getMilliseconds().longValue());
        assertNull(c.getExponentialBackoff());
       
        b.setExponentialBackoff(new RMAssertion.ExponentialBackoff());
        c = RM10PolicyUtils.intersect(a, b);
        assertEquals(7200000L, c.getInactivityTimeout().getMilliseconds().longValue());
        assertEquals(20000L, c.getBaseRetransmissionInterval().getMilliseconds().longValue());
        assertEquals(2000L, c.getAcknowledgementInterval().getMilliseconds().longValue());
        assertNotNull(c.getExponentialBackoff());   
    }
   
    @Test
    public void testGetRMAssertion() {
        RMAssertion a = new RMAssertion();
        BaseRetransmissionInterval abri = new RMAssertion.BaseRetransmissionInterval();
        abri.setMilliseconds(new Long(3000));
        a.setBaseRetransmissionInterval(abri);
        a.setExponentialBackoff(new RMAssertion.ExponentialBackoff());
       
        Message message = control.createMock(Message.class);
        EasyMock.expect(message.get(AssertionInfoMap.class)).andReturn(null);
        control.replay();
        assertSame(a, RM10PolicyUtils.getRMAssertion(a, message));
        control.verify();
       
        control.reset();
        AssertionInfoMap aim = control.createMock(AssertionInfoMap.class);
        EasyMock.expect(message.get(AssertionInfoMap.class)).andReturn(aim);
        Collection<AssertionInfo> ais = new ArrayList<AssertionInfo>();
        EasyMock.expect(aim.get(RM10Constants.RMASSERTION_QNAME)).andReturn(ais);
        control.replay();
        assertSame(a, RM10PolicyUtils.getRMAssertion(a, message));
        control.verify();
       
        control.reset();
        RMAssertion b = new RMAssertion();
        BaseRetransmissionInterval bbri = new RMAssertion.BaseRetransmissionInterval();
        bbri.setMilliseconds(new Long(2000));
        b.setBaseRetransmissionInterval(bbri);
        JaxbAssertion<RMAssertion> assertion = new JaxbAssertion<RMAssertion>();
        assertion.setName(RM10Constants.RMASSERTION_QNAME);
        assertion.setData(b);
        AssertionInfo ai = new AssertionInfo(assertion);
        ais.add(ai);
        EasyMock.expect(message.get(AssertionInfoMap.class)).andReturn(aim);
        EasyMock.expect(aim.get(RM10Constants.RMASSERTION_QNAME)).andReturn(ais);
        control.replay();
        RMAssertion c = RM10PolicyUtils.getRMAssertion(a, message);
        assertNull(c.getAcknowledgementInterval());
        assertNull(c.getInactivityTimeout());
        assertEquals(2000L, c.getBaseRetransmissionInterval().getMilliseconds().longValue());
        assertNotNull(c.getExponentialBackoff());  
        control.verify();
    }
   
}
